Your Opportunity
The Business Transformation Office function is responsible for supporting the rest of Sidel with process implementation as well as IT projects and services to automate the Sidel Business Processes. We do this by employing a modern set of software and applications on a global scale. We are constantly updating and improving our software and application landscape in order to simplify our processes and how we work and to decrease cost and to improve efficiency and effectiveness. We annually execute 40+ projects, ranging from small change request projects to large multi-million ERP implementation projects.
We are seeking an information specialist who will work with colleagues and consultants to develop and improve the performance of our IT systems for the Services Area, one of the key strategic areas of Sidel.
The information specialist must have good knowledge of Project Systems tools (especially SAP ECC PS) to help in maintain and developing ‘engineering to order’ solutions.
You will work under the responsibility of the Business Analyst to specify, develop, maintain and improve the performance of solutions that automate our business processes. You will also monitor the global performance of IT services which support the core process and take proactive and/or reactive steps to restore or improve service performance.
The deployment of robust IT solutions for after sales portfolio products (spare parts, service, training, planned maintenance, retrofit) is a fundamental pillar of Sidel’s transformation strategy. The selected IT analyst will join Sidel to contribute to this highly visible and strategic programme.
